Tips
- Mention reservation check-in/out dates to prevent back-and-forth.
- Quote the exact cancellation clause from your confirmation email.
- BCC yourself to track sent emails and follow-ups easily.

FAQ
Q: Does a 'free cancellation' guarantee a full refund?
A: Not always; some free cancellations offer credit, not cash. Verify terms.
Q: What if the vendor ignores my refund email?
A: Document all communication and contact your payment provider for chargeback.
